1

Software Engineer Applied Math Jobs in Massachusetts

Software Engineer 3

Wilmington, MA

$62.75 - $84.50/hr

PhD, MS, or Bachelor's degree in Electrical Engineering, Computer Science, Applied Mathematics ... Experience with software development methodologies such as Agile, Scrum, or Kanban. * Experience ...

Software Engineer 3

Wilmington, MA · On-site

$62.75 - $84.50/hr

PhD, MS, or Bachelor's degree in Electrical Engineering, Computer Science, Applied Mathematics ... Experience with software development methodologies such as Agile, Scrum, or Kanban. * Experience ...

... Applied Mathematics, Electrical Engineering, or related field * Ability to obtain and maintain a ... Experience with software quality tools (static/dynamic analysis, automated testing frameworks) Pay ...

Associate Software Engineer

Woburn, MA · On-site

$93K - $115K/yr

... Applied Mathematics, Electrical Engineering, or related field * Ability to obtain and maintain a ... Experience with software quality tools (static/dynamic analysis, automated testing frameworks) Pay ...

Senior Software Engineer

Woburn, MA · On-site

$139K - $180K/yr

... Applied Mathematics, Electrical Engineering, or related field * Ability to obtain a security ... Experience with software quality tools (static/dynamic analysis, automated testing frameworks) Pay ...

... Applied Mathematics, Electrical Engineering, or related field * Ability to obtain a security ... Experience with software quality tools (static/dynamic analysis, automated testing frameworks) Pay ...

Senior Software Engineer

Wilmington, MA · On-site

$133K - $176K/yr

PhD, MS, or Bachelor's degree in Electrical Engineering, Computer Science, Applied Mathematics ... Experience with software development methodologies such as Agile, Scrum, or Kanban. * Experience ...

Senior Software Engineer

Upton, MA · On-site

$133K - $175K/yr

Software Engineer Onto Innovation is a leader in process control, combining global scale with an ... PhD, MS, or Bachelor's degree in Electrical Engineering, Computer Science, Applied Mathematics ...

Senior Software Engineer

Wilmington, MA · On-site

$133K - $176K/yr

PhD, MS, or Bachelor's degree in Electrical Engineering, Computer Science, Applied Mathematics ... Experience with software development methodologies such as Agile, Scrum, or Kanban. * Experience ...

Software Developer Location: This position is Onsite. The candidate MUST live within 100 miles of ... Position requires the candidate to possess a BS/BA in Physics, Engineering, Applied Math or ...

Software Developer Location: This position is Onsite. The candidate MUST live within 100 miles of ... Position requires the candidate to possess a BS/BA in Physics, Engineering, Applied Math or ...

... Applied Mathematics, Electrical Engineering, or related field * Ability to obtain and maintain a ... Experience with software quality tools (static/dynamic analysis, automated testing frameworks) Pay ...

next page

Showing results 1-20

Software Engineer Applied Math information

See Massachusetts salary details

$69.3K

$161.1K

$224.4K

How much do software engineer applied math jobs pay per year?

As of Jun 21, 2026, the average yearly pay for software engineer applied math in Massachusetts is $161,114.00, according to ZipRecruiter salary data. Most workers in this role earn between $131,100.00 and $188,900.00 per year, depending on experience, location, and employer.

What types of projects do Software Engineers in Applied Math typically work on?

Software Engineers specializing in Applied Math are often involved in developing algorithms, simulations, and analytical software that solve complex, real-world problems in fields like finance, engineering, machine learning, or data science. Daily responsibilities may include implementing mathematical models, optimizing existing code for performance, and collaborating with cross-disciplinary teams to refine solutions. Depending on the employer, you might work on projects such as risk modeling, signal processing, optimization engines, or predictive analytics tools. This role frequently requires balancing theoretical problem solving with practical software implementation to deliver robust, scalable applications. Working closely with researchers, data scientists, and other engineers, you will contribute to innovation and technical excellence in your organization's projects.

What is a Software Engineer Applied Math job?

A Software Engineer in Applied Math develops and implements mathematical models, algorithms, and simulations to solve complex problems in various domains such as finance, engineering, and data science. They use programming languages like Python, C++, or MATLAB to create efficient solutions based on numerical analysis, optimization, and machine learning. This role often involves collaborating with scientists, analysts, and engineers to enhance computational methods and improve decision-making processes.

What are the key skills and qualifications needed to thrive in the Software Engineer Applied Math position, and why are they important?

To thrive as a Software Engineer Applied Math, you need a solid background in computer science, mathematical modeling, and software engineering, often supported by a relevant degree such as computer science, applied mathematics, or engineering. Expertise in programming languages (such as Python, C++, or MATLAB), experience with numerical libraries and data analysis tools, and familiarity with version control systems are typically required. Strong analytical thinking, effective problem-solving, and the ability to communicate complex technical concepts are important soft skills for this role. These skills enable you to build efficient software solutions for complex mathematical problems, drive innovation, and collaborate effectively within technical teams.

What are the most commonly searched types of Software Engineer Applied Math jobs in Massachusetts? The most popular types of Software Engineer Applied Math jobs in Massachusetts are:
What are popular job titles related to Software Engineer Applied Math jobs in Massachusetts? For Software Engineer Applied Math jobs in Massachusetts, the most frequently searched job titles are:
What job categories do people searching Software Engineer Applied Math jobs in Massachusetts look for? The top searched job categories for Software Engineer Applied Math jobs in Massachusetts are:
Software Engineer 3

Software Engineer 3

Onto

Wilmington, MA

$62.75 - $84.50/hr

Other

Medical, Dental, Vision, Life, Retirement, PTO

Posted 5 days ago


Job description

Onto Innovation is a leader in process control, combining global scale with an expanded portfolio of leading-edge technologies that include: 3D metrology spanning the chip from nanometer-scale transistors to micron-level die-interconnects; macro defect inspection of wafers and packages; metal interconnect composition; factory analytics; and lithography for advanced semiconductor packaging. Our breadth of offerings across the entire semiconductor value chain helps our customers solve their most difficult yield, device performance, quality, and reliability issues. Onto Innovation strives to optimize customers' critical path of progress by making them smarter, faster and more efficient.
Job Summary & Responsibilities
We are looking for a Software Engineer to join the Inspection Business Unit (IBU). Whether you are launching your career or bringing years of deep expertise, what matters most is how you think: we need someone who can hold a global, system-level view of a complex inspection platform-optics, mechanics, electronics, and software-and then zoom into any layer to get into the weeds when a problem demands it.
Because AI coding agents can now generate and refactor code effectively, the critical skill we are seeking is the ability to maintain an accurate mental model of a complex system consisting of optics, electrical, and mechanical subsystems, and effectively map customer problems to the right technical solutions.
Key Responsibilities
Responsibilities will be scoped to your experience level; early-career engineers will focus on the foundational items while senior engineers will take on broader ownership and leadership.
Systems Thinking & Problem Decomposition

  • Build and continuously refine an accurate mental model of the full Onto inspection platform-optics, motion, electronics, image acquisition, and software stack.
  • Translate customer problems and application requirements into well-scoped engineering tasks by reasoning across subsystem boundaries.
  • Agility to zoom from system-level architecture down into any specific areas: databases, algorithm performance, hardware, data flow, GPUs, GUIs, etc.
  • Participate in New Product Development (NPD) alongside hardware engineers, application engineers, Technical Project Managers, and Program/Product Managers.
Algorithms & Software Engineering
  • Apply machine learning, image processing, computer vision, mathematics, and optics to develop algorithms integrated into Onto inspection platforms.
  • Develop or contribute to optical imaging modeling/calibration and/or image segmentation, classification, and detection algorithms.
  • Write, test, and debug software to ensure high-quality, reliable operation; optimize for performance and scalability.
  • Perform or lead (based on experience) requirement analysis, detailed software design, production code development, and associated test plans.
  • Participate in design/code reviews collaborating with systems engineers, software developers, and other technical staff.
  • Leverage AI coding agents to accelerate implementation, while maintaining ownership of architecture decisions, design integrity, and code quality.
Continuous Learning & Collaboration
  • Stay current with academic research and industrial practices in machine vision inspection, image processing, machine learning, and AI-assisted engineering.
  • Document software designs, system-level rationale, development processes, and troubleshooting steps.
  • Support teammates and, at senior levels, provide technical mentorship-especially in systems thinking.
  • Contribute to improving the team's development workflows and tooling, including AI-assisted practices.
Qualifications
  • 0-5 years of experience.
  • PhD, MS, or Bachelor's degree in Electrical Engineering, Computer Science, Applied Mathematics, Physics, or related field.
  • Demonstrated ability to reason about systems at multiple levels of abstraction-from high-level architecture down to implementation details.
  • Strong problem-solving, analytical, and communication skills; able to articulate complex system behavior clearly to both technical and non-technical stakeholders.
  • Competency (or demonstrable coursework) in at least one numerically focused environment such as Python or MATLAB, including linear algebra, image processing, and/or machine learning libraries
Preferred Qualifications
  • Experience in semiconductor inspection, machine vision, robotics, or similar highly technical domains where hardware/software co-design is essential.
  • Track record of diagnosing cross-subsystem issues that span optics, electronics, firmware, and application software.
  • Experience effectively using AI coding agents (e.g., Copilot, Cursor, Aider, or similar) to accelerate development.
  • Experience with software development methodologies such as Agile, Scrum, or Kanban.
  • Experience with version control and CI/CD practices.
  • Experience debugging complex multi-threaded software environments.
  • Familiarity with embedded systems, hardware communication protocols, and/or real-time constraints.
  • Competency (or demonstrable coursework) in at least one compiled or production language used in large-scale software systems, such as C++, C#, or Java.
Why Join Onto Innovation?
At Onto Innovation, we believe your work should matter-and so should your well-being. That's why we offer competitive salaries and a comprehensive benefits package designed to support you and your family. From health, dental, and vision coverage to life and disability insurance, PTO, and a 401(k) with employer match, we've got you covered. You'll also enjoy access to our Employee Stock Purchase Program (ESPP), wellness initiatives, and cutting-edge tools-all within a collaborative, inclusive culture where your contributions are valued and recognized.
Compensation & Growth
• Base Salary Range:
$115,200.00 - $172,800.00, offered in good faith and based on experience, location, and qualifications.
  • Additional Rewards: Annual bonus opportunities and potential long-term incentives tied to both company and individual success.

Empowering Every Voice to Shape the Future:
Onto Innovation is committed to creating a workplace where every qualified candidate has an equal opportunity to succeed. We evaluate applicants based on skills, experience, and potential - without regard to race, color, religion, gender, sexual orientation, national origin, age, disability, veteran status, or any other characteristic protected by law. We believe diversity of thought and background drives innovation and strengthens our team.
Important Note on Export Compliance
For certain positions requiring access to technical data, U.S. export licensing review may be necessary for applicants who are not U.S. Citizens, Permanent Residents, or other protected persons under 8 U.S.C. 1324b(a)(3).

ONTO logo

About ONTO

Sourced by ZipRecruiter

Industry

Specialized design services

Company size

1 - 10 Employees

Headquarters location

New York, NY, US

Year founded

2021